Kathryn M. Shaw Lamb
Kathryn M. Shaw Lamb, age 84, of Lawrence Park, passed away Friday February 6, 2009 at the Hamot Medical Center. She was born in Calgary, Alberta Canada on July 27, 1924 daughter of the late Goddard "Doc and Greta Holmes Shaw. She is survived by a son Terrance Lamb and his companion Judith Cochran of Waterford, a daughter Jackie Lamb-Anderson and her husband the Rev. Dr. Ralph Anderson of West Seneca, N.Y. Kathryn is also survived by her grandchildren: Krista Thomas and her husband Mark, their children Elliot and Tristian, Meghan Cann and her husband Matt, their children Aidan, Ava and Own, Joshua Anderson and his wife Teresa and their son Gavin, Jacob Anderson and Gerald Anderson. She was preceded in death by her husband of 43 years and the former Chief of Police of the Lawrence Park Police Department, Gerald R. Lamb. She was a Companion of Health Care Aide taking care of all her elderly neighbors, always showing them the greatest care and kindness. Kathryn was a Civil War Buff and a voracious reader. She was always rescuing animals. Although loving all her pets, her cat Sheridan was her beloved companion. She also enjoyed collecting antiques.
